Here's What You'll DoJOB
Summary:
The LVN/LPT is responsible to assist the with the coordination of the home so that the residents' health and safety needs are met, assists to maintaincompliance under the California Code of Regulations (CCR), Title 17 and Title 22 as well as the Lanterman Act (Welfare and Institutions Code).
The LVN/LPT isexpected to ensure residents to maximize independence.
JOB
Responsibilities:
Administer medications to individuals and follow the five rights for verification purposesAttend residents' doctor appointments and address any concerns and changes with the attending physicianAssist individuals with activities of daily living such as bathing, cleaning, preparing meals, grooming, cooking, cleaning etc.
Assess residents' and participants' wounds, help with dressing change and breathing treatments, as neededAudit all medications during a new medication cycle and check the five rights for verificationPerform g-tube insertions for feeding to individualsPerform colostomy care to individualsPerform intramuscular injectionsPerform diabetes insulin medication injection to individualsEvaluate residents' and participants' level of consciousness, neurological factors, and whether they are responsive and oriented post seizure and/or any traumatic episodesRedirect in the event of a behavioral episode and continue to support and listen to individual's needsComplete and update client notes system on a daily basis.
Observe and report any unusual behaviors and injuries so both Behavior Consultant and Administrator are fully informedAssess and identify sign and symptoms of infections (early and late signs)Perform basic physical review such as checking for vital signs, (understanding normal and abnormal measures) and head to toe assessmentsParticipate in community outing events with the individuals such as hiking, going to the beach, and other leisure activitiesPerforms other related duties and assignments as required Essential FunctionsOutline and prepare daily routine(s) for clients' (visual and active) as written in Individual Program Plan.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
